Chapter 80 I Have To Find Her
“Alpha, we received the report from Papeno,” Samuel said as he rushed into the war room.
James had purposely kept Romero away from today‘s meetings until we received this info. It was only my men and the king in the war room.
“Go ahead,” I said.
“We confirmed that military vessels have been sighted.”
I sneered, “As expected.”
James turned to me. “So you think Romero is allowing them to restock and refuel on his island?”
James and I had suspicions as to Romero‘s strategy. If he had been playing both sides of the field, most likely, he would have made the same deal with Kal as he did with us.
My gut was telling me he was lending some small islands to Alpha Kal for their military operations.
“Logically, it explains our problems.” | paced back to the map. “There‘s an open ocean between Kal and us. If they didn‘t have a middle point, they would need more large cargo ships to carry the smaller vessels, which we would have been able to locate as soon as they entered our waters.”
Turning back to face James, I continued, “But we didn‘t, because those ships are much smaller. But that means they need to be restocked and refueled somewhere much closer to us.”
James responded, “Even if that‘s the case, there‘s no value in confronting him. We still need to work with him.”
“True. Especially since Romero could just say those are his own ships.”
Most importantly, we didn‘t want to alert him to the fact that we were on to him.
“How many vessels are there?” I asked Samuel.
“We saw four, but we estimated two more to be on patrol.”
James and I exchanged a look– six ships. Someone higher in rank had to be around to oversee their operation.
“Were you able to locate which island their leader might be stationed on?”
“No, Alpha. Papeno is not a single island; it‘s a group of them. While we could see several naval bases, they were guarded by Romero‘s men. Kal‘s commander could be on any of the nearby islands.”
I looked at James, silently asking if that was enough evidence to order a trip to Romero‘s islands.
After a moment, he nodded his head,
I took over the meeting and laid out the operation plan.
“I need a team of thirty, divided into three groups–twelve, twelve, and six. The goal of this mission is to assassinate the target in charge of the operations around Papeno. Additionally, we are here to obtain a detailed map of the islands and where their supplies are. If needed– if we fail to achieve our primary objective–then, in the future, we can send men to destroy their supplies.”
James never interfered with my work. Once I got his go–ahead, I was fully in charge of the operation.
